Photography Review
14 years ago

Purchased 70-300L for use on my 7D for daylight field sports, and most importantly, to carry while when traveling. Processed (in Lightroom & NIK Suite) images from the 7D + 70-300L compare very favorably with those from my 5D MkII + 70-200L MkII.
Pros:
  • Compact
  • Light weight
  • Fast auto focus (with both full and panning modes)
  • Full time manual focus
  • Very sharp images
  • Responds well to micro focus adjustment
Cons:
  • Cost, but then again it has 'L' build quality and performance
  • Lens collar is both expensive and (currently) unavailable

Canon EF 70-300mm f4-5.6 IS USM

Canon's 70-300mm f4-5.6 IS USM lens is a step up from the average telephoto zoom. Canon also makes a much cheaper 75-300mm, but the lens tested here is designed for photographers looking for a step up in both build and picture quality – and this lens has an image stabiliser.
